The importants of this bug has been set to high and the number of
duplicates is staty growing.
A workaround for those who are affected:
$ sudo vim /etc/shadow
change the line:
root:!:13919:0:9:7::1:
to
root:!:13919:0:9:7:::
You have to redo this everytime you use 'passwd -l $USER'

The line in /usr/share/kolab-webadmin/admin/include/mysmarty.php
require_once('smarty/libs/Smarty.class.php');
should be
require_once('smarty/Smarty.class.php');
Another workaround is:
cd /usr/share/php/smarty && ln -s . libs
